Remodeling your entire home involves many variables that shift your final bill. The biggest factor is the scope of work; moving plumbing or knocking down load-bearing walls costs significantly more than simple cosmetic updates like new flooring or paint. Your choice of materials also creates a wide gap, as custom cabinetry and high-end stone counters carry a premium compared to stock options.
